In the international market IndiGo is currently ranked as India’s sixth largest carrier behind local operators Jet Airways, Air India, low-cost carrier Air India Express and Gulf giants Emirates Airline and Etihad Airways. It will this year hold a 4.1 per cent share of international capacity from India, based on published schedules, up from 3.2 per cent in 2016.
As first revealed by our Airlineroute news stream in the middle of last month, Qatar Airways is deploying the first LATAM aircraft on one of its two daily flights between Doha and Munich. It debuted on the QR059/060 rotation from March 2, 2017 and another of the LATAM airframes will be used on the second QR057/058 service from April 1, 2017. The additional two LATAM A350-900s will be used on Qatar Airways’ Doha – Madrid route.
